您当前的位置: 首页 > 知识百科 > 微信小程序悬浮菜单按钮怎么实现?

微信小程序悬浮菜单按钮怎么实现?

时间:2023-07-01 14:05 阅读数:112 人阅读 分类:知识百科

  微信小程序悬浮菜按钮怎么实现?在微信小程序的界面可以开发出微信小程序悬浮菜单按钮哦,这样微信小程序用户的体验就会更加的棒哟,那么微信小程序悬浮菜单按钮怎么实现呢?

  微信小程序悬浮菜单按钮怎么实现?

  微信小程序悬浮菜单按钮实现的方法特别多,本文主要用2个方法。

  + translate3d(x,y,z)定义 3D小程序数据缩放转换。

  + rotate3d(x,y,z,angle) 定义 3D 旋转。

  translate3d(1,1,0)

  你可以理解为(左右,上下,大小)变化。

  rotate3d(1,1,0,45deg)

  怎么实现微信小程序悬浮菜单按钮?

  1.两朵云除了大小和初始位置不通,其他都相同。

  .cloud {

  position: absolute;

  z-inqwtdex: 3;

  width:99pafx;heightwef:64px; top: 0;

  right: 0;

  bottom: 0;

  aetnimation: cloud 5s linear infinite;

  }w

  @keyframes cloud {

  from {

  transftorm: tranqslate3d(-125rpx, 0, 0);

  }

  to {

  transftqwaorm: trarwqnslate3d(180rpx, 0, 0);

  }

  }

  其中rpx是微信小程序开发特有的属*,不受屏幕大小的影响,类似于安卓里的dp单位。keyframes是匀速移动,从css里可以看到只改变了左右方向。

  2.头像本来想加个吊篮,像荡秋千一样的荡漾,但是没有成功,只是随便搞了个飘来飘去的小程序动画。

  微信小程序代码如下:

  @keyframes pic {

  0% {

  transformg: translate3d(0, 20rpx, 0) rotate(-15deg);

  }

  15% {

  transform: translate3d(0dga, 0rpx, 0) rotate(25deg);

  }

  36% {

  transform: translate3d(0, –20rpx, 0) rotate(-20deg);

  }ga

  50% {

  transform: translagaste3d(0, –10rpx, 0) rotate(15deg);

  }

  68% {

  transform: tragnslate3gasd(0, 10rpx, 0) rotate(-25deg);

  }

  85% {

  transformasg: translate3d(0, 15rpx, 0) rotate(15deg);

  }g

  100% {

  transform: traasgnslate3d(0, a rotate(-15deg);

  }

  }

  没想到keyframes不仅有支持from to还支持百分比,不错。这里,只要控制好层级关系、动画时长、透明度即可实现微信小程序悬浮菜单按钮。

  各位微信小程序管理员,你希望自己的微信小程序用户更加的多吗?所以你有必要学习以上的微信小程序悬浮菜单按钮开发的方法哦,感谢大家对我们的支持,更多精彩相关的内容尽在微小乔。

微信小程序悬浮按钮怎么创建?

微信小程序悬浮按钮如何固定在微信小程序底部?

微信小程序悬浮层怎么实现?